Logical fallacies are viewpoints brought up during arguments which appear logical on the surface, but when you dig a little deeper are in fact mostly unfounded. One common fallacy is the appeal to authority, where you assume that just because someone is an "authority," that they have to be right. For example, "Pope Urban VIII said that Galileo's views were wrong, so since I trust the Pope I'm going to agree with the Pope and say that the universe is actually geocentric." Sometimes the flaw is that the "authority" isn't actually authoritative in the topic in question - the Pope isn't an astronomer, the President of the US isn't a meteorologist, etc. But even if the "authority" is actually an authority, that doesn't make him/her automatically correct. Even authorities make mistakes - look at Tycho Brahe for example. This is also the entire point of peer reviewed journals, to give the authorities the chance to duke it out.
So that said, when the NY Times Magazine devotes a 28-screen-long article to singing Freeman Dyson's laurels as a motivation for us to listen to his arguments about CO_2 levels, I find myself quite disappointed. Dyson is an authority on quantum physics and sci-fi concepts (such as the Dyson sphere, which led to Larry Niven's Ringworld concept/series); he is NOT an authority on environmental science. I don't care how many people think he's a genius, he isn't a genius in this field. And even if he were, even authorities can make mistakes. It is NOT appropriate for the NY Times to promote an individual's ideas based solely upon that individual's reputation. If the article were billing itself as a biography of Dyson's life, it could be an excellent one, but the article is trying to give us a view of Dyson's ideas and as such it is a remarkably poor one.
I guess in the end by expecting the NY Times to live up to its reputation, I too am guilty of putting too much faith in authority.

Belt of Venus
On an evening flight from Minnesota to Connecticut Friday evening, I finally saw the Belt of Venus for the first time. I didn't have my camera handy and photos through windows never come out well anyway, so here's a photo from a Google search:

The Belt of Venus is actually the Earth's own shadow cast in the sky. As you probably already know, the bright blue of the daytime sky is due to light from the Sun being scattered by dust in the atmosphere. When you take away that light from the Sun, what you're left with is a dark sky. The Belt of Venus appears on the Eastern horizon just after the Sun is sets in the West because the sunlight doesn't reach the Eastern horizon at that time. This is also why I suspect I haven't ever seen it previously - too high a horizon all around me where I live.

"The Fair Copyright in Research Works Act"
The Fair Copyright in Research Works Act is supposedly intended to protect the intellectual property of scientists and their funding sources. Right now the NIH requires that all research funded by them be made available to the public for free after a certain proprietary period (in addition to their usual publication in peer-reviewed journals). Passing the bill would allow the NIH (and other federal groups such as the NSF, etc.) to remove this requirement from federally funded researchers, so that the researchers could choose to (or additional private funding sources could require them to) only publish their work in expensive peer-reviewed journals.
There is some debate about whether this is really as bad as it sounds. On the one hand, it sounds like the Act would allow the stifling of scientific communications and would mean that the American public would have to pay twice to see the work that their taxes paid for. On the other hand, it's my understanding that all federally funded research is required to be public domain and it's not clear that this Act would counteract that, or that the NIH and other federal groups would choose to do what the Act would allow. In addition, it might allow researchers to use multiple funding sources for a project which they may be unable to do right now - pharmaceutical companies may require NDAs for their work which the NIH regulations currently rule out since the researchers have to publish publicly.

Windmill saves ski resort $450k/year
More land-using organizations should start putting up wind turbines, if the results from Jiminy Peak Mountain Resort in Hancock MA is any indication. Putting up a single turbine is saving them $450,000 per year, around 1/3 of their energy bill. Fortunately for them, the windmill produces the most electricity during the winter when it's the most windy, and seeing as they're a sky resort it's also when they use the most electricity (primarily due to their snow-making machines). (I can't help but think that if more companies used turbines, that we'd slow global warming and ski resorts wouldn't need to make fake snow as much.)
Also interestingly during the summer months the turbine produces more electricity than the Jiminy Peak uses. It appears they have not actually worked out a buy-back program for the excess electricity (where their utility company would actually pay *them* if they produced more electricity than they used), so instead the excess power goes into the grid - where it is then used up by local residents, reducing their reliance on the power company, on fossil fuels (coal burning is the primary source of electricity even in the Northeast US), and even their electricity bills. So this project has helped not only the ski resort, but also the local community.
Just don't tell the bats - the action of the turbine results in extremely low pressure air behind the turbine, which then results in internal bleeding. Shame that every improvement in one field leads to a problem in another. Time will tell whether the net good outweighs the net bad.
